SSASIT offers B.E. courses in five specializations. The minimum eligibility to apply in this program is 10+2 with 45% (40% for SC/ST and SEBC) with Physics and Mathematics as compulsory subjects. Selection will be on the basis of the score obtained in GUJCET. Allotment of seats will be through counseling.
Applicants seeking admission through GUJCET can apply online by visiting the GSEB website. New applicants are required to register their candidature before filling out the online application form. Candidates can obtain the information brochure and PIN for registration by paying INR 350 at any of the listed “help centers” assigned by the board.
The process of online application post-registration is as follows:
• After filling in all the requisite details, the applicant will then need to upload the scanned copies of the photograph and signature in the specified format.
• The candidate must obtain a DD of INR 300 in favor of "Secretary, Gujarat Common Entrance Test Cell” payable at Gandhinagar.
• Upon submission of the application form, a unique application number will be created for each applicant which he/she will need to preserve for future correspondence.
• A print-out of the complete application form and self-attested photocopies of the required documents must be submitted at the nearby help Centre from June 1, 2021, to June 12, 2023.
• The requisite acknowledgment slip after submission of the registration form is to be collected from the Help Centre.
• Candidates who qualify for GUJCET 2023 will need to attend counseling for further admission process.
